When it comes to keeping your pup healthy, one of the most important things you can do is deworming. But sometimes, it can be hard to find the best dog dewormer without a vet prescription. That’s why it’s important to know the key points to consider when looking for the best dewormer for your pup.

First, check the active ingredients in the dewormer. Different dewormers target different kinds of worms, so it’s important to make sure the active ingredients are appropriate for your pup. Also, check the age and weight range listed on the packaging. Some dewormers are specifically formulated for puppies, while others are meant for adult dogs.

Next, read the reviews and consult your vet. Before you purchase a dewormer, read reviews from other pet owners to get an idea of the product’s effectiveness and safety. Also, consult your vet to make sure the dewormer is appropriate for your pup.

Third, consider the dosage form. Most dewormers come in either tablet or liquid form. Tablets are easier to administer but may not be as palatable for some dogs. Liquid dewormers, on the other hand, are easier to mix into food.

Finally, look for natural, chemical-free options. If you’re looking for a more natural option, there are some chemical-free dewormers available on the market. These are usually made with ingredients like pumpkin seed or garlic, which are thought to help expel worms from the body.

When it comes to choosing the best dog dewormer without a vet prescription, it’s important to consider the active ingredients, reviews, dosage form, and natural ingredients. With a bit of research and consultation with your vet, you can find the perfect dewormer for your pup.

9. Nemex-2 Wormer 2oz

Nemex-2 Wormer is a safe, convenient and palatable solution for controlling large roundworms and hookworms in dogs. Each 2 oz bottle contains 4.54 mg of pyrantel pamoate per ml, making it a safe and effective method for controlling these parasites in puppies. This dewormer is designed to be easy to administer, making it a great choice for busy pet parents.

Nemex-2 Wormer can be used to remove and control large roundworms and hookworms in dogs. It is effective against roundworms such as Toxocara canis, Toxascaris leonina, and Uncinaria stenocephala, as well as hookworms such as Ancylostoma caninum and Uncinaria stenocephala. This dewormer is safe for puppies, and can be used as young as two weeks of age.

What is the best dewormer over-the-counter for dogs?

The best over-the-counter dewormer for dogs is pyrantel pamoate. This medication is effective against roundworms, hookworms, and whipworms. It is available in liquid and tablet form and is safe for puppies and adult dogs. Pyrantel pamoate works by paralyzing the worms, which are then passed out of the body in the dog's stool. It is important to note that this medication does not kill the eggs of the worms, so it is important to repeat the treatment in two to four weeks to ensure all worms and eggs are eliminated.

It is important to consult with a veterinarian before administering any medication to your dog. This is especially true for dewormers, as some worms can be resistant to certain medications. Additionally, some dewormers can be toxic to puppies or dogs with certain health conditions. Your veterinarian can help you determine the best dewormer for your dog and provide instructions on how to properly administer it.

In addition to dewormers, it is important to practice good hygiene and sanitation to help prevent worms from infecting your dog. This includes regularly cleaning up after your dog, disposing of feces in a sealed bag, and washing your hands after handling your dog or their waste. Additionally, it is important to keep your dog away from areas where other dogs may have defecated, as this can increase the risk of infection.
